1,588 research outputs found

    A multi-mode sonar transmitter

    Get PDF
    This project was initiated to evaluate appropriate microprocessor and digital logic techniques that could increase the flexibility and effectiveness of a sonar transmitter. The study led to a multi-channel signal synthesis concept designed to exploit 'phased array' steering techniques. Two versions of the equipment have now been built and evaluated. Mk.I is a relatively low power 15 channel system with 2 kilowatts total electrical power using a 40 kHz 15 λ x 1 line array. This system proved the practicability of the basic concept and its success led to the 16 kilowatt Mk2 high power version which drives a 16λ x 16 λ wideband transducer array. The study included: The design and construction of a multi-channel signal generator. The writing of control and signal synthesis software. The design, evaluation and commissioning of suitable linear power amplifiers . Investigations into suitable transducers and phased array design, leading to the manufacture of suitable matched wide band multi-channel 'staved' transducer arrays. Finally, a series of trials were made in a variety of open water conditions to evaluate the systems performance and investigate the multiple modes of operation that have been developed. The system has successfully demonstrated that transmitter beam steering is both practical and flexible. The techniques implemented permit sector interrogation by 'within-pulse' type sweeps, by 'Ripple-fire' and by transmitting steered 'Pings' sequentially on prededermined bearings. Each mode allows considerable flexibility in the generated waveform shape and frequency. The 'Multi-Mode' capability of this approach was conceived primarily as a research tool but many of the modes can be isolated and exploited in dedicated applications

    Measuring Complexity and Stability of Web Programs�

    Get PDF
    Software maintenance engineers spend at least half of their time trying to understand the system they are to modify. This is due partially to the fact that often the only documentation available is the source code itself. The literate programming paradigm provides the incentive and the capability to produce high quality documentation and code simultaneously. The goal is to create "works of literature" which have all the extras (table of contents, cross references, and indices) to help readers to comprehend the programs quickly and thoroughly. The purpose of this thesis is to explore the similarities and differences in measurements of complexity and stability of literate programs compared to those of traditionally developed code.Computer Scienc

    An annotated and classified bibliography of software metrics publications : 1988 to 1994

    Get PDF
    With the growth of the software industry, the measurement of software plays an ever increasing role. In order to provide software metric researchers and practitioners with references so they can quickly identify the references of particular interest to them, over 60 of the many publications on software metrics that have appeared since 1988 are classified into four tables that comprise, respectively, (1) Metrics through the Life Cycle, (2) Classic Metrics, (3) Programming Language Metrics, and (4) New Metrics. Table 1 serves as a complete list of all the classified publications while Table 2, Table 3 and Table 4 are subsets of Table 1. The subset tables present more detailed information than Table 1. The bibliographic reference section contains brief summaries of the publications in the classified tables. As a continuation of the 1988 survey done by V. Cote, P. Bourque, S. Oligny and N. Rivard through the paper, "Software metrics: an overview of recent results", this project was conducted to discover the current trends in software metrics practice, and to report the trend movement from the 1988 paper until now by comparison of the results from the two surveys. All the table comparisons from the two surveys are given in percentages. As a survey, we are fully aware of the limitations of our collection out of the wealth of the publications in the software metrics field, but we are confident that our survey is a good indicator of the practice in the software metrics field. [Résumé abrégé par UMI]

    SPCATS (Sound Programme Circuit Automatic Test-Set)

    Get PDF

    Brexit Dilemmas: Shaping Postwithdrawal Relations with a Leaving State

    Full text link
    How do voters want their governments to respond when another country unilaterally withdraws from an international institution? We distinguish between negotiation approaches that vary in the degree to which they accommodate the withdrawing state's demands and argue that negotiation preferences are shaped by two issues. The first is voters’ exposure to the costs and benefits of accommodation. This exposure varies across issues, and we argue that citizens will generally prefer non-accommodation on zero-sum issues, but support more accommodation on cooperation issues, where non-accommodation puts existing cooperation gains at risk. Second, withdrawal negotiations create precedents, and citizens should therefore be less willing to accommodate the more they are concerned about the ripple effects of accommodation on the institution's stability. These concerns also confront citizens with two types of dilemmas depending on how favorably they view the institution themselves. To test our argument, we use survey evidence and a conjoint experiment conducted in Germany and Spain during the Brexit negotiations. We find that respondents overall are more willing to accommodate the UK on cooperation issues than on zero-sum issues, but also find evidence that Euroskeptics and Europhiles confront different issue-specific dilemmas. Our paper contributes to a better understanding of the dynamics surrounding the challenges to multilateralism that have proliferated in recent years

    Excimer-laser-induced modifications of optical surfaces

    Get PDF
    The work in this thesis is a study of the interactions of a well characterized high power ultra violet excimer laser beam with solid optical quality surfaces, principally Al and Ge but with limited work on dielectrics. In order to characterize the beam and to monitor the changes induced on test surfaces by the beam, a computer controlled image processing system was developed. The system used the fluorescence from a UV absorbing glass to image the excimer beam and Schlieren imaging of the test surfaces with cw HeNe or pulsed dye laser illumination to monitor the induced changes. [Continues.

    Enhancing the Impact of Cross-Sector Partnerships. Four Impact Loops for Channeling Partnership Studies

    Get PDF
    This paper addresses the topic of this special symposium issue: how to enhance the impact of cross-sector partnerships. The paper takes stock of two related discussions: the discourse in cross-sector partnership research on how to assess impact and the discourse in impact assessment research on how to deal with more complex organizations and projects. We argue that there is growing need and recognition for cross-fertilization between the two areas. Cross-sector partnerships are reaching a paradigmatic status in society, but both research and practice need more thorough evidence of their impacts and of the conditions under which these impacts can be enhanced. This paper develops a framework that should enable a constructive interchange between the two research areas, while also framing existing research into more precise categories that can lead to knowledge accumulation. We address the preconditions for such a framework and discuss how the constituent parts of this framework interact. We distinguish four different pathways or impact loops that refer to four distinct orders of impact. The paper concludes by applying these insights to the four papers included in this special issue

    ON THE ECONOMICS OF THE-SOFTWARE REPLACEMENT PROBLEM

    Get PDF
    Software maintenance constitutes a significant fraction of the software budget. The cost of maintaining old applications has been escalating and this trend is likely to continue in the foreseeable future. The study of software maintenance strategies has become important to both researchers and practitioners in Information Systems. While there is a rich literature on the technical aspects of software maintenance, research on the economics of maintenance is in its infancy. In particular, the tradeoffs between maintaining and rewriting old software have not been investigated from a theoretical standpoint. In this paper, we present an economic model of the software replacement problem. Based on available empirical evidence, we hypothesize that, with frequent modifications and enhancements, the complexity of software increases rapidly. This deterioration of the code leads to a sharp increase in the maintenance cost. Thus, there may exist a time when it is optimal (in an economic sense) to rewrite the system, which reduces the system complexity and the subsequent maintenance cost. The proposed model allows us to compare the economics of various rewriting strategies and to determine the optimal rewriting point(s). Some interesting results with implications for the systems manager are obtained from the analysis. These include the impacts of system size, structuredness of the underlying technology, and the availability of superior technologies upon the rewriting point(s) and life cycle costs. A numerical example is provided to demonstrate the applicability of the model

    Design and control of a synchronous reluctance machine drive

    Get PDF
    This thesis investigates the design, performance and control of a synchronous reluctance machine (Synchrel) drive. The Synchrel machine is proposed for variable speed drives because of its advantages over other machines. The rotor has no cage winding, brushes or slip rings. The torque ripple levels are lower in the Synchrel machine than the switched reluctance machine as it operates from a standard sine wave supply. An axially laminated rotor was designed based on finite element analysis, with the aim of producing the same output power as obtained from an induction motor (M) with a similar stator. Using vector control, the developed torque is controlled by regulating the stator current vector. Two vector control schemes are used, maximum torque per ampere and constant current in the direct axis. The output torque characteristics of the machine have been confirmed by finite element analysis. Slotine's approach of sliding mode control is used for position control of the vector controlled synchronous reluctance machine. A comparison is undertaken between the performance of a fixed gain controller with two sliding mode controllers, for both the regulator and servo cases. Invariant performance is obtained using Slotine's sliding mode control approach, unlike with a fixed gain controller. Robustness to parameter variation is an important feature of this technique. This robustness can be achieved through the control law design, assuming parameter variation bounds are known. These improvements are demonstrated for variations in load inertia. Inductance ripple affects machine performance, for example decreasing output torque and increasing core losses. A state space model for the machine that incorporates this inductance effect, yields drive simulation results that agree with experimental results
    • …
    corecore